While Zaino is easy to apply it takes a LONG time.
The procedure they recommend is:
1. wash car with Zaino cleaner
2. wash car again with dawn dish washing detergent (to take off any existing wax, dealers sometimes put on wax)
3. clay bar entire car
4. Apply first coat (Z-7 or Z-5 I forget)
5. Apply coat of (Z-5 or Z-7 whichever wasn't in stead 4).
6. Spray and wipe Z-9 antistatic

Continue adding coats of Z-5/Z-7 depending on how shiny you want it.

I for one did everything, including 3 coats of Z-5 3 months after I got my car. Then re-applied Z-7, Z-5, Z-9 6 months later. Then repeated steps 1-6 one year later.

Don't get me wrong I :heart: zaino, but the full process takes a good 6 hours depending on how hot it is. The colder it is the longer time it takes the wax to dry.
